John Bevere is a renowned author, speaker, and teacher in the Christian community. With a passion for seeing individuals grow in their faith and understanding of God’s Word, he has dedicated his life to sharing biblical principles and empowering believers to live a life of purpose and impact.

Born and raised in Colorado, John’s personal journey of faith began early in his life. After encountering Jesus at the age of 19, he embarked on a profound spiritual transformation that ignited a deep desire to help others experience the same life-changing encounter with God.

His writing career took off in the late 1990s with the release of his groundbreaking book, “The Bait of Satan,” a powerful exploration of the destructive nature of offense and the importance of forgiveness. This book quickly became a bestselling classic, resonating with readers around the world and solidifying John’s position as a trusted voice in the Christian community.

Since then, John Bevere has authored numerous books, including “Good or God,” “Driven by Eternity,” and “Under Cover,” all of which have captured the hearts and minds of readers seeking spiritual growth and biblical wisdom. From tackling topics such as discerning God’s voice and navigating challenges in relationships, to understanding the role of authority and living with a heavenly perspective, his writings offer practical insights and dynamic revelations that inspire profound transformation.

3.Can you explain the concept of the bait of Satan and its impact on individuals’ lives?

The concept of the bait of Satan refers to the strategies used by the enemy to trap and entangle individuals in offenses, unforgiveness, and bitterness. These snares are carefully laid out to hinder our spiritual growth and negatively impact our relationships with God and others.

Offenses are like bait, enticing us to dwell on the wrong that has been done to us. When we take the bait, we willingly enter a trap, allowing bitterness and resentment to take root in our hearts. This not only hinders our own peace and joy, but it also disrupts our connection with God and damages our relationships with others.

The impact of the bait of Satan is significant. It can lead to a cycle of unforgiveness, bitterness, and isolation, preventing us from experiencing true freedom and healing. Our spiritual growth is hindered, our prayers remain unanswered, and our hearts are hardened. Ultimately, it hinders our ability to love and serve God and others wholeheartedly.

Recognizing the bait of Satan is key to breaking free from its grip. We must guard our hearts against offenses, choosing forgiveness and releasing others from the debts we feel they owe us. By choosing to walk in forgiveness and extending grace, we close the door to the enemy’s influence and open ourselves up to restoration, freedom, and a deeper intimacy with God.

5.You emphasize the importance of forgiveness. Can you discuss the role of forgiveness in overcoming the bait of Satan and share practical advice on how individuals can forgive those who have hurt them?

Forgiveness plays a crucial role in overcoming the bait of Satan as it releases us from the bondage of bitterness and resentment. When we hold onto unforgiveness, we actually allow Satan to gain a foothold in our lives, leading to a cycle of hurt, anger, and broken relationships.

To forgive those who have hurt us, it is important to understand that forgiveness is not about condoning the wrongdoing or forgetting the pain. Instead, it’s a choice to release the offender from the debt they owe us. It’s an act of obedience to God and a means of finding freedom and healing.

Practically, forgiveness starts with acknowledging the pain and choosing to let go of the offense. It may require expressing our feelings in a safe and healthy way, but ultimately, we need to release our right to retaliate and trust God’s justice. Additionally, we must guard against the temptation to revisit the offense or dwell on it in our thoughts.

Forgiveness is a difficult and ongoing process, but through prayer, relying on God’s strength, and seeking His perspective, we can find the grace to extend forgiveness. It is also helpful to remember God’s forgiveness towards us, realizing that we are not in a position to withhold forgiveness from others.

By choosing to forgive, we break the cycle of offense and find freedom to move forward in our relationships with both God and others.

10. Can you recommend more books like The Bait Of Satan?

a) “Battlefield of the Mind” by Joyce Meyer: This empowering book offers practical strategies to overcome destructive thinking patterns and negative emotions, helping readers find freedom from mental battles.

b) “The Screwtape Letters” by C.S. Lewis: In this classic allegorical novel, Lewis delves into the world of spiritual warfare by exploring the tactics of demons as they attempt to influence human behavior. It offers thought-provoking insights into the nature of temptation and the importance of staying vigilant.

c) “The Bondage Breaker” by Neil T. Anderson: Filled with biblical teachings and personal anecdotes, Anderson provides a comprehensive guide to breaking free from spiritual bondage. This book equips readers with the tools necessary to resist the enemy’s schemes and live a victorious life.

d) “Victory in Spiritual Warfare” by Tony Evans: Evans offers readers a deep understanding of spiritual warfare and explores the authority believers have in Christ. With practical insights and biblical wisdom, this book empowers readers to overcome the enemy’s tactics and experience true victory.

e) “The Invisible War” by Chip Ingram: This book explores the reality of spiritual warfare and guides readers through practical steps to identify and combat the enemy’s attacks. Ingram provides a clear understanding of how Satan operates and exposes his tactics, allowing readers to defend themselves with the truth of God’s Word.
